Meaning of

aaina-gari

आईना-गरी • آئینہ گری

mirror-making; art of reflection

दर्पण निर्माण; प्रतिबिंब की कला

آئینہ سازی; عکس کی فن

Persian

Aaina-gari evokes the delicate craft of creating mirrors, a metaphor for introspection and self-reflection. In poetry, it symbolizes the art of capturing the soul's essence, reflecting the inner truths and hidden desires.

Poets often use aaina-gari to explore themes of self-discovery and the duality of appearance versus reality. It serves as a canvas for expressing the complexities of identity and the search for truth.
